Gktorrents is a BitTorrent indexing website that provides access to millions of torrent files, allowing users to download movies, TV series, music, software, video games, and ebooks for free. In many cases, Gktorrents does not require user registration, lowering the barrier for those seeking free digital content. The site is widely known among French users due to its extensive collection of content with French audio and subtitles (VF and VOSTFR), filling a gap left by platforms like T411, which was shut down in 2017, and NexTorrent. It operates as a "tracker," meaning it helps users find other peers sharing the same files. Some speculate that the same developers behind NexTorrent are also behind Gktorrents.

In France and neighboring European countries, sharing copyrighted material via peer-to-peer (P2P) networks is illegal. Because BitTorrent architecture requires downloaders to simultaneously upload pieces of the file to other peers, your public IP address is visible to everyone in the swarm—including anti-piracy monitoring agencies. Many countries require ISPs to block access to well-known pirate sites. If you find the site is blocked, you might be tempted to look for "proxy" or "mirror" sites. This is a dangerous path, as these unofficial clones are often set up by scammers specifically to infect your computer.
